NorCAL BOYS: San Ramon Valley Edges Danville Monte Vista

Attackman Josh Redhair scored a team-high four goals to lead San Ramon Valley to an 11-10 victory over Danville Monte Vista in a CIF-North Coast Section East Bay Athletic League game Friday night.

Michael Tagliaferri added three goals, Ross Rudow had three points on a goal and two assists and Patrick Worstell and Dylan Gonsalves each finished with a goal and an assist to help San Ramon Valley (8-6, 5-3 EBAL) win for the second time in its last three games.

Chase Miller had a goal, which stood up to be the game-winner, to round out the scoring for the Wolves.

Goalie Michael Schleicher saved 11 shots.

In a losing effort, junior attackman Ryan Lieber finished with a game-high five points on four goals and an assist, and senior attackman Mitch Stein had a pair of goals for Monte Vista (8-5, 5-3), which had its two-game winning streak snapped.

Junior middie Cody Soberanes, sophomore attackman Jarrod Welker, senior middie Matt O’Brien and sophomore middie Jarrett Hassfeld all had single goals.

Defensively, senior goalie Trevor Moriarty saved 13 shots.

Monte Vista led 2-1 at the end of the first quarter, the game was tied, 5-5, at halftime and San Ramon Valley led 8-5 going into the fourth quarter.

The Wolves extended their lead to 11-6 when Miller scored with 7:56 to play in regulation, but the Mustangs rallied to make a game of it. Monte Vista scored four goals over the next 4:14, a run capped by Welker, who scored with 3:42 to play to make it, 11-10.

But Monte Vista could not get the equalizer. Its final shot came with two seconds remaining, but sophomore attackman Casey Hock’s effort sailed inches wide.
